I live in the beautiful Shenandoah Valley, right at the very tip of West Virginia's Eastern Panhandle.

My city, Martinsburg, is often referred to as the "Gateway to Shenandoah Valley" and has been named the "fastest expanding city in the state."

With an estimated population of 18,835 as of 2021, it's undoubtedly the biggest city in the Eastern Panhandle.

In my city, you'll find many shops and historical homes in the old downtown district.

One of the best things about living here is the abundance of excellent restaurants that serve various dishes for different budgets.

I'm excited to share with you the 15 best restaurants in Martinsburg, West Virginia.

Kobe Japanese Steak House & Sushi Bar

Signage of Kobe Japanese Steak House & Sushi Bar
Foursquare City Guide

Kobe Japanese Steak House & Sushi Bar is a place to enjoy Teppanyaki, a popular style of Japanese cooking.

In teppanyaki restaurants, the chef prepares the meal right before the diners on a flat, solid iron griddle.

I was impressed by how the restaurant has been working relentlessly to provide customers with a genuine taste of Japan through its cuisine.

The teppanyaki experience was prepared by trained professionals who guided me through an exciting and engaging dining experience.

They whipped up a mouthwatering stir-fry dish on my table using the freshest ingredients and the most meticulously picked seasonings.

I've heard that their sushi, sashimi, and combination rolls by their skilled sushi chefs are guaranteed to be the freshest you've ever had.

In addition, they have a full sushi bar that can satisfy even the pickiest of sushi eaters.

I visited them at Viking Way for a one-of-a-kind meal.

The cook was my favorite part of the experience.  He was engaging, funny, and wonderful to watch!

Historic McFarland House

The Historic McFarland House is a classic landmark in Martinsburg, known for its all-you-can-eat Sunday brunch buffet.

This hidden gem is located near downtown Martinsburg behind a classic brick exterior.

The Historic McFarland House has been a symbol of the city's culture, history, and pride for over 140 years.

When I stepped inside, I was taken into another era, to a more elegant and charming period.

The glorious history of the estate, which was constructed by Alexander B. Parks in 1878, is carried on in the home's decor, cuisine, and social gatherings.

The current house owners continue Parks' tradition of using only locally sourced ingredients in the cooking and decor.

I couldn't resist trying the house-made brioche French toast served with genuine West Virginia maple syrup.

The Thai basil chicken and smoked salmon with dill cream cheese are two of the restaurant's most popular dishes, and they were perfect when I was looking for something hearty to eat.

Keep in mind that you may only enjoy their brunch buffet on Sundays.
